1. Casual Gamers

๐ŸŽญ Who They Are

Casual gamers are people who play games to relax, pass time, or simply enjoy entertainment. They don’t take gaming as a profession or competition. For them, gaming is just like watching a movie or scrolling on social media.

๐ŸŽฎ Devices They Use

Since they play for limited time, they usually rely on basic devices they already own, such as smartphones, PCs, or laptops. However, most casual gamers prefer smartphones because they allow quick and easy gaming sessions.

๐Ÿ› ️ Needs & Preferences

- Prefer simple games instead of long tutorials or complex controls.
- Want games that can be started or stopped anytime.
- Don’t spend hours grinding for levels.
- Enjoy games with bright colors, simple stories, and addictive mechanics.

๐Ÿ’ฐ Budget

Casual gamers usually don’t spend much. Their priority is low-cost or free games. They don’t mind ads as long as they can play for free. If they do spend, it’s usually on:

  • Small in-game purchases ($1–$20)
  • Budget accessories (cheap headphones, basic controllers)
  • Budget consoles or entry-level smartphone upgrades

Average Spend Range: $0 – $200
